Beacon EmbeddedWorks (Beacon), formerly Logic PD, is a long established (20+ years) company with an enviable blue chip customer base, selling into multiple segments through multiple channels, in the US and worldwide. Having been acquired by discoverIE Group plc in 2021, Beacon has established a market leading design, in-house manufacturing and lifecycle support capability and is now looking to scale its business on this strong foundation. At this exciting time in the company’s journey, Beacon Group is looking for the senior-most technology leader responsible for setting technology direction, shaping the product and solution portfolio, and providing customer-facing technical credibility across Beacon EmbeddedWorks and Diamond Technologies. This is a strategic, growth-oriented role. The Chief Technology Officer (CTO) ensures that technology and product decisions directly support revenue growth, sales effectiveness, margin improvement, and long-term enterprise value. Technology choices are treated as business and investment decisions, not standalone engineering efforts. The role is intentionally not focused on day-to-day engineering execution. Instead, the CTO focuses on portfolio direction, platform strategy, risk management, and converting technology investment into measurable commercial outcomes. ABOUT DISCOVERIE Beacon is part of discoverIE Group plc, a British company listed on the main London stock exchange where it is a member of the FTSE 250 index. discoverIE Group plc is an international group of businesses that designs, manufactures, and supplies customized, innovative, and application-specific components for electronic applications. In-house engineers work closely with customers to design bespoke products for their specific requirements; these are then manufactured and supplied, usually on a repeating revenue basis, for their ongoing production needs. This model generates a high level of recurring revenue and long-term customer relationships. The group operates across a wide range of industry segments but focuses particularly on key target markets which are driven by structural growth and increasing electronic content: medical, renewable energy, industrial connectivity, and transportation. The Group aims to achieve organic growth that is well ahead of GDP and to supplement that with targeted, complementary acquisitions. Over the last seven years, sales have more than doubled and operating profits have grown five-fold. The Group has a market capitalization of $850M (August 2025) and for the year ending 31st March, 2025 generated revenues of $570M and underlying profit before tax of $81M. The Group employs c.4,500 people and its principal operating units are in Continental Europe, the UK, China, Sri Lanka, India, and North America.
